M.I Abaga Calls On Other Nigerian Tribes To Stand With The Igbos

by Chiamaka
Jun 2, 2021 | 14:33
in News

width=576

Ace rapper, Jude Abaga, fondly known as M.I has called on other Nigerian tribes to join hands with the Igbos amidst the unrest in the eastern part of the country.

Following the invasion by unknown gunmen and the horrendous killings of the Igbos in the east (Imo State, Orlu LGA), M.I Abaga took to Twitter to plead with other Nigerian tribes to stand with the Igbos in this unpleasant time as the Federal government is yet to intervene.

The 39-year-old artist who hails from the northern part of Nigeria encouraged Netizens to voice their solidarity with the Igbos by tweeting about the injustice.

According to him, the Igbos can’t fix the years of hurt, but other Nigerians can help heal the igbos if they stand with them to make right the wrongs done to them.

All of us non igbo Nigerians should make tomorrow a day of solidarity to stand with our Igbo brothers and sisters.. we cannot fix years of hurt.. but we can with one voice say we are one.. we are together!!!

Even if na only me do am I go do am

What # could we use?

”” Yung denzL (@MI_Abaga) June 1, 2021

The narrative that Nigeria hates Igbo people is an outdated context that will leave with the old and bitter generation

Today let us stand with our Igbo family and say #IAmIgboToo #Ozoemena ???? pic.twitter.com/B0xGAjnfMG

”” Yung denzL (@MI_Abaga) June 2, 2021
